  • Installation of memory on Intel Celeron 110 430 64-bit desktop computer HP

    It is best to install the 1 module (8 GB) or 2 (modules of 4 GB memory) on the HP 110 430 [RAM of 4 GB 500 Intel Celeron 1800] thanks for the help.

    Which until support via two connectors DIMM 240-pin DDR3 dual channel memory architecture .  It would be better to install 2 match DDR3 DIMM PC3-10600 (1333 MHz).

    The better question is whether or not your computer accepts more than 2 GB of memory, and if so, what memory support or accept.  Once you have an answer to this question then you need determine if the additional memory will help.  Which would be determined by looking at the performance of the system in system monitoring tools and watching low available memory and/or high swap file usage.

  • Presario CQ56 Intel Celeron Dual-Core T3500

    Hello

    I wonder if I am able to upgrade my processor to an Intel® Core™ 2 Duo T9550 processor.

    I currently have an Intel Celeron Dual - Core T3500, two processes run on the decision-making PGA478 Penryn. So I guess that it would be a problem?

    All the answers in this regard would be very appreciated.

    See you soon.

    The information provided just enough.

    I wish I had better news to give you.

    Unfortunately there is no BIOS support for the duo T9500 Core 2 CPU. The real problem is the GL-40 Intel chipset on the motherboard. It does not support the mobile Core 2 duo CPU

    The following illustration shows only two processors that are guaranteed compatible. Neither one has the grunt of a Core2duo CPU.

    source reference: Guide to maintenance & Service for the Compaq Presario CQ56 Notebook PC and laptop of HP G56
